I’ve always been fascinated by the intricacies of localhost and its differences from a live server. In this article, I’ll be sharing my insights on mastering the art of understanding localhost.
demystifying understanding localhost and its differences is agreed useful to know, many guides online will take action you approximately demystifying understanding localhost and its differences, however i recommend you checking this demystifying understanding localhost and its differences . I used this a couple of months ago taking into consideration i was searching on google for demystifying understanding localhost and its differences
We’ll explore common uses, delve into the basics, and uncover the nuances that set it apart from a live server.
Mastering the Art of Understanding Localhost and Its Differences is unquestionably useful to know, many guides online will law you approximately Mastering the Art of Understanding Localhost and Its Differences, however i recommend you checking this Mastering the Art of Understanding Localhost and Its Differences . I used this a couple of months ago later than i was searching upon google for Mastering the Art of Understanding Localhost and Its Differences
In order to truly master the art of understanding localhost and its unique characteristics, it is essential to delve into the realm of “Localhost Understanding Mastery.”
Additionally, we’ll troubleshoot any issues that may arise and even touch on advanced techniques for optimizing localhost performance.
So let’s dive in and gain full control over this essential tool!
In this comprehensive guide, we delve into the intricacies of developing web applications and unravel the mysteries surrounding localhost. Throughout the article, our aim is to demystify understanding localhost and its differences, enabling you to master it effortlessly.
Check Out These Related Posts – Unlocking Business Success: A Step-by-step Guide to Obtaining a Sales Tax Permit in North Dakota
Common Uses of Localhost
If you’re curious about the various ways localhost is commonly used, let’s dive into some examples.
Localhost refers to the computer you are currently using. It allows developers to test and run applications locally before deploying them to a remote server. One major advantage of using localhost is that it provides a controlled environment for development and debugging purposes. Unlike a remote server, localhost allows developers to have direct access and control over the entire system. This level of control enables faster development iterations and troubleshooting capabilities.
However, there are also drawbacks to using localhost compared to a remote server. One significant disadvantage is that localhost lacks the scalability and availability features provided by remote servers.
When developing on localhost, it’s essential to consider security considerations carefully. Localhost development poses lower risks compared to testing on a live website accessible from the internet since it is not exposed externally. However, security measures such as securing database connections, implementing user authentication mechanisms, and regularly updating software should still be followed to ensure data integrity and prevent any potential breaches or attacks during development stages.
Other Relevant Articles – Unlocking Success: The Ultimate Guide to Launching a Profitable Property Management Company in Hawaii
Exploring the Basics of Localhost
Exploring the basics of localhost can help you understand how it works. Setting up a localhost environment is crucial for web development because it allows you to create and test websites locally before deploying them to a live server. The benefits of using localhost for web development are numerous.
Firstly, setting up a localhost environment gives you complete control over your website’s development process. You can experiment with different designs, functionalities, and plugins without affecting the live version of your site.
Secondly, working on localhost ensures faster loading times since you’re not dependent on an internet connection. This enables developers to work efficiently and make quick changes without any delays.
Additionally, using localhost provides a safe and secure way to test new features or updates before making them available to the public. You can identify and fix any issues or bugs without causing disruptions to your users’ experience.
Overall, understanding the basics of localhost is essential for web developers who seek efficiency, control, and reliability in their work.
Other Relevant Articles – Embracing the Power of Fritzbox 7360
Understanding the Differences Between Localhost and Live Server
To fully grasp how to utilize both localhost and a live server effectively, you should analyze the contrasting aspects between these two environments.
Localhost is a development environment that allows you to test your website or application on your local machine before deploying it to a live server. It provides a controlled environment where you can experiment and make changes without affecting the public-facing version of your site.
One key aspect of working with localhost is testing the connections between different components of your application to ensure they are functioning correctly. Additionally, securing your localhost environment is crucial to protect sensitive data and prevent unauthorized access.
By understanding the differences between localhost and live server, you can optimize your development process and ensure a smooth transition when deploying your project.
Now let’s delve into troubleshooting localhost issues in the next section.
Troubleshooting Localhost Issues
When troubleshooting localhost issues, start by checking your server configuration and ensuring that all necessary services are running properly. Here are some debugging techniques for localhost issues:
- Verify network connectivity:
- Check if the network adapter is enabled and configured correctly.
- Ensure that the IP address and subnet mask are set up correctly.
- Check firewall settings:
- Make sure that the firewall allows incoming connections to your localhost.
- Disable any third-party firewalls temporarily to see if they’re causing the issue.
Troubleshooting network connectivity problems with localhost can be complex, but following these steps will help you identify and resolve any issues. Remember to document each step you take to make it easier for future reference.
Advanced Techniques for Optimizing Localhost Performance
You can improve localhost performance by optimizing your server’s configuration and reducing unnecessary services. By implementing various performance tuning techniques for localhost, you can enhance your development workflow and ensure a smoother experience. Here are some key optimizations to consider:
|Caching||Utilize caching mechanisms to store frequently accessed data and reduce the load on the server.||Faster response times and improved scalability|
|Compression||Enable compression of files to reduce their size, resulting in faster transfer over the network.||Reduced bandwidth usage and improved page load times|
|Database indexing||Optimize database queries by creating indexes on frequently used columns for faster data retrieval.||Improved query performance and reduced database load|
In conclusion, understanding the concept of localhost and its differences from a live server is crucial for developers.
By exploring its basics and common uses, troubleshooting any issues that may arise, and employing advanced techniques to optimize performance, developers can master the art of working with localhost effectively.
This knowledge will enable them to create and test websites or applications locally before deploying them to a live server, ensuring a smooth and efficient development process.
Firefly Events Nashville is a renowned event planning company that excels in organizing memorable experiences. With their expertise and attention to detail, they effortlessly orchestrate seamless events that leave a lasting impact. Firefly Events Nashville truly masters the art of understanding localhost and its differences, ensuring that every event they create is a remarkable success.